Venue accessibility summary
Luxe Cinemas offers step-free access to its main entrance and pathways for wheelchair, mobility scooter, and walking aid users. The venue features a clearly labelled, gender-neutral accessible restroom with grabrails and ample space for transfers. Service animals are welcome and have access to all areas of the venue.
Visitor experience



- Designated and clearly-marked accessible parking spaces are available.
- There is one accessible curbside parking space, shared with the library and other local businesses.
- Step-free access to the curb is available from the passenger side, though drivers self-transferring should exercise caution due to street traffic.
- The closest accessible parking space is located within 30 metres of the main entrance.
- The car park is well-lit at night.
- Visitors can reach this site using public transport, with bus services available.
- The closest public transport stop is within 200 metres of the venue entrance.
- A safe footpath leads to the main entrance for people who are blind or experience low vision.
- There are no designated drop-off and pick-up points.
- The pathway leading to the main entrance does not have tactile ground surface indicators.

- Activities offer a wide range of sensory experiences and stimuli for visitors with sensory modulation needs.
- Participants can easily remove themselves from activities if they experience sensory overload or discomfort.
- Staff are able to intervene quickly if audiovisual systems project sound or graphics that may induce seizures or be distressing.
- Headphones are available for visitors watching movies to reduce external noise and distractions, especially useful for neurodiverse guests.
- There is no designated breakout room or quiet space for visitors who require it.
- The temperature of all indoor venues can be adjusted to accommodate visitors who require controlled room temperatures.
- A sheltered space is available for visitors in the event of sudden bad weather.
- The venue hosts events and activities.
- Events and activities utilise audiovisual equipment such as film screens and sound systems.
- Closed captions, subtitles, or Sign Language interpretation are not available for video events.
- Audio descriptions for video events are not indicated as applicable or available for visitors with blindness or low vision.
- Activity environments feature even, non-slip flooring and unobstructed pathways suitable for participants with blindness or low vision.
- Activity environments include clearly-displayed signs or graphics suitable for participants who are deaf or experience limited hearing.
- Luxe Cinemas is a staffed venue.
- Some staff have received workplace education and training on accessibility and inclusion.
- Staff are aware of the venue's accessible features and services and are able to provide assistance.
- Staff can assist visitors who do not communicate verbally.
- Staff are available to assist visitors with blindness or low vision if needed.
- Staff are available to assist visitors with intellectual disabilities if needed.
- Staff are available to assist visitors with acquired brain injuries if needed.
- Staff are able to assist people requiring mobility assistance with emergency escape routes.
- Clear directions, signs, and maps are available to guide visitors, including to emergency exits.
- A feedback mechanism is in place for visitors to raise accessibility concerns or provide suggestions.
